India and Japan sign USD 75 billion currency swap agreement
India and Japan Monday concluded a USD 75 billion bilateral currency swap agreement, a move that will help in bringing greater stability in foreign exchange and capital markets in the country. India’s first RO-PAX ferry to set sail from Ghogha Port on 27th October
India’s first RO-PAX ferry service between Ghogha and Dahej ports will be launched by honorable chief minister, Shri Vijaybhai Rupani on 27th October 2018, as the vessel ‘Voyage Symphony’ is primed to set sail on its maiden journey from Ghogha Terminal. Adultery not an offense says Supreme Court strike down IPC 497
Today five-judge Constitution bench of the Supreme Court jointly ruled to scrap Section 497,on adultery, of IPC the Indian Penal Code.
